Routine

I spent the first three weeks of January working on speed drills. No I am incorporating some hill work into my routine. This morning’s workout consisted of:
1 mile at 5 mph (12 min mile) at an incline of 5
1 mile at 6 mph (1o min mile) at an incline of 1.5
1 mile at 7 mph (8.3 min mile) at an incline of 1.5
and then a repeat of the first two miles.

I've been averaging 30-40 miles a week. Mostly inside on the treadmill but once in a while I'm able to get outside -- that's a real delight!
